MOTIONS IN OPEN SESSION
The City Attorney read the following motion into the record:
A Motion To Authorize The Sale Of City Owned Property Located
At 3540 9th Avenue To Be Listed By A Licensed Real Estate Broker
As Required By Section 253.014 Of The Texas Local Government
Code And The City Manager Is Authorized To Execute A Contract
With A Licensed Broker And Final Approval Of The Sale Will Be
Brought Back For Approval By The City Council
Upon the motion of Councilmember Kinlaw, seconded by Councilmember Holmes and
carried, the above-mentioned motion was adopted.
Voting Yes: Mayor Bartle; Councilmembers Holmes, Kinlaw, Marks and Frank.
Voting No: None.
The City Attorney read the following motion into the record:
A MOTION TO ALLOW THE CITY MANAGER TO EXECUTE AN
EXTENSION BETWEEN THE CITY AND SIDDONS-MARTIN, INC.
ALLOWING A DUE DATE ADJUSTMENT BASED ON THE NATURAL
DISASTER AND WAIVING ANY PENALTY CLAUSE
Upon the motion of Councilmember Kinlaw, seconded by Councilmember Holmes and
carried, the above-mentioned motion was adopted.
Voting Yes: Mayor Bartie; Councilmembers Holmes, Kinlaw, Marks and Frank.
Voting No: None.
